Born Harold Galper on April 18, 1938 in Salem, Massachusetts, the jazz pianist, composer, and bandleader is better known as Hal Galper. Studying classical piano at the age of six, he eventually switched to jazz and studied at the Berklee College of Music between 1955 and 1958. Hanging out quite frequently at the Stable – a club owned by jazz trumpeter Herb Pomeroy – he eventually became the house pianist.
